Step 1: Choose Your Chain Length

Chain length determines where the pendant sits on your body, which affects both the look and how it flatters your neckline. Here’s a quick reference:

  • 14–16 inches (choker/collar) - Sits at the base of the neck; best for open necklines and V-necks
  • 18 inches (princess) - The most popular length; sits just below the collarbone and works with almost any neckline
  • 20–22 inches (matinee) - Falls at or just above the bust; elegant for both casual and formal wear
  • 24–30 inches (opera/rope) - Long and dramatic; ideal for layering or wearing with high necklines

If you’re unsure, 18 inches is the safest starting point - it’s universally flattering and pairs well with most outfits.

Step 2: Match the Pendant to Your Neckline

The shape of your neckline should guide your pendant choice:

  • V-neck or scoop neck - A teardrop, geometric, or elongated pendant echoes the neckline beautifully
  • Crew neck or high neck - A longer chain with a statement pendant creates visual interest
  • Off-shoulder or strapless - A delicate pendant on a shorter chain keeps the focus on your décolletage
  • Collared shirt or turtleneck - A longer pendant worn over the fabric adds dimension

Step 3: Consider the Pendant Size

Pendant size should be proportional to your frame and the occasion:

  • Delicate, small pendants - Subtle and refined; perfect for everyday wear and layering
  • Medium pendants - Versatile; work for both casual and dressed-up looks
  • Statement pendants - Bold and eye-catching; best worn as the focal point of an outfit with minimal other jewelry

Step 4: Choose Your Metal

Sterling silver is a timeless choice for pendant necklaces. Its cool, bright tone complements a wide range of skin tones and pairs beautifully with both casual and formal outfits. It’s also more affordable than gold, making it an excellent option for building a versatile jewelry wardrobe.

When choosing sterling silver, look for pieces stamped with “925” this indicates 92.5% pure silver content, the standard for quality sterling silver jewelry.

Step 5: Think About the Occasion

  • Everyday wear - Choose a lightweight, durable pendant on a simple chain. Geometric shapes and minimalist designs work well.
  • Special occasions - A pendant with a gemstone accent like moissanite adds elegance and catches the light beautifully.
  • Gifting - Meaningful symbols (hearts, stars, initials) make pendant necklaces a thoughtful and personal gift.

Layering Pendant Necklaces

One of the most popular jewelry trends is layering multiple necklaces at different lengths. To do this successfully:

  • Vary the chain lengths by at least 2 inches between each piece
  • Mix pendant sizes one statement piece with one or two delicate ones
  • Keep metals consistent for a cohesive look, or intentionally mix for an eclectic style
  • Use a necklace layering clasp to keep chains from tangling
